ffmpeg 下如何编译x11grab

6034阅读 0评论2012-01-31 wwm
分类:LINUX

一般是由于缺少libxext-dev和libxfixes-dev
apt-get install libxext-dev
apt-get install libxfixes-dev

 ./configure --prefix=/usr/local/ffmpeg083/ --enable-gpl --enable-version3 --enable-nonfree --enable-postproc --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libtheora --enable-libvorbis --enable-libx264 --enable-libxvid --enable-x11grab --enable-libmp3lame --enable-libfaac --enable-libvo-aacenc --enable-libvpx --disable-optimizations --disable-mmx --disable-mmx2 --disable-ssse3 --extra-cflags='-O0 -fno-inline' --enable-debug --enable-ffplay

结:找了半天采知道问题所在。看来要认真看configure文件,然后再用apt-cache search 找类似库。
enabled x11grab && check_header X11/Xlib.h && check_header X11/extensions/XShm.h && check_header X11/extensions/Xfixes.h && check_func XOpenDisplay -lX11 && check_func XShmCreateImage -lX11 -lXext && check_func XFixesGetCursorImage -lX11 -lXext -lXfixes

上一篇:净空老法师开示:这样持念“阿弥陀佛”最好
下一篇:webm使用时候ffmpeg参数优化